2011-09-20 22 views
0

我有一個桌面應用程序,它可以使用TCP/IP與服務器應用程序對話。它一直在工作,但現在我們遇到了一個問題。服務器中的日誌消息顯示套接字在一段時間後斷開連接,但我們能夠交換心跳消息。當我運行WhireShark工具時,我得到這個日誌,我不知道如何解釋。排除我的應用程序中的tcp/ip連接失敗

enter image description here

的另一件事是,當我運行在服務器運行它只是正常工作的LAN這個應用程序。

請幫我理解網絡中發生了什麼。

回答

0

我很難看到跟蹤細節,但它看起來像.218是客戶端試圖連接到.135?如果是這樣,218的連接嘗試(SYN)立即被135(RST)拒絕。正常的3路TCP握手應該是SYN,SYN-ACK,ACK。

如果服務器正在接受來自其他主機的請求有某種防火牆,或者排序設置爲允許本地LAN連接但不允許遠程主機?

相關問題